Certifications and Accreditations



When picking an industrial paint professional, ensuring they have the necessary certifications and qualifications is essential. Look for specialists who are certified and guaranteed. A valid permit indicates that the contractor has met the requirements set by regulatory bodies and is legally permitted to perform paint solutions. Insurance is important as it protects both you and the service provider in case of crashes or damages throughout the job.



Qualifications in painting techniques or particular products can additionally be helpful. These qualifications show that the contractor has actually gone through specialized training and is experienced about the most up to date industry criteria.

Furthermore, inspect if the contractor is associated with professional organizations in the paint market. Membership in such organizations can indicate a commitment to high quality work and adherence to moral techniques.

Before hiring a commercial painting specialist, ask about their credentials and certifications. Do not think twice to demand proof of licensing, insurance, and any type of appropriate accreditations. By picking a professional with the ideal certifications, you can make sure a smooth and effective painting job.

Profile Examination



To assess a business painting specialist's capabilities and style, assessing their portfolio is necessary. A portfolio showcases the professional's previous jobs, giving you a glimpse of their work top quality, range of services, and expertise.

When evaluating their portfolio, take notice of the kind of tasks they have actually completed. Look for projects comparable in scope and scale to yours to ensure they've the experience and abilities needed for your task. Assess the general quality of their job, including attention to detail, precision in execution, and adherence to due dates.

Interaction and Agreement Terms



After examining a business paint service provider's portfolio and validating their competence lines up with your project requirements, the following vital step is to develop clear communication channels and agree on agreement terms. Effective communication is vital to a successful collaboration with your paint professional. See to it you clearly convey your assumptions, timelines, and any specific information concerning the job. Ask the specialist concerning their liked communication approaches and ensure they're receptive to your questions.

When it concerns acquire terms, be detailed and detail-oriented.
